Assessment of Nitrate Reductase Activity in the Leaves of Terminalia chebula

Combinations of different concentrations of substrate (0.10M, O.15M, O.20M, and O.25M KNO3) with different pH of buffer (O.20M, KH2P04 of the pH 6.5,7.0, 7.5, 7.6, 7.7, 7.8, 7.9 and 8.0) soiutions were tried for the nitrate reductase activity of Terminalia chebula leaves. Maximum nitrate reductase activity was observed in the combination of buffer solution of O.20M having pH 7.6 and substrate solution 01 the concentration O.15M.
